Additional Chief Secretary To Government, Women and Child Development Department
Sudeep Singh Dhillon, born on 16 December 1957, is a retired Indian Administrative Service officer from the 1984 Haryana cadre. He holds a B.E. in Civil Engineering, a PG Diploma in Structural Engineering, and a PG Diploma in Public Administration from Syracuse University. Dhillon served as Additional Chief Secretary to the Government in the Women and Child Development Department from 21 August 2017. Throughout his career, he held multiple key positions including Additional Principal Secretary to the Chief Minister, Principal Secretary, Finance Commissioner, Commissioner & Secretary, and Managing Director. He received the National Award for e-Governance in 2008-09.
